Great full color collection of the New Mutants origin
I had been reading a lot of the Essential X-Men books, which are great in their collection of continuous stories, but this graphic novel takes it two steps further. 1) It's in full color and really makes a much more engaging read with glossy pages. 2) It goes beyond just the first handful of issues of the series' chronology. It includes the first introduction of Karma in an issue of Fantastic Four, and then with the rest of the team's assemblage before taking you through their first 12 issues. An added bonus is the four part mini-series at the end, Magik: Storm and Illyana, that details the time Illyana spent trapped in Limbo and her journey to becoming a daemonic sorceress - extra nerd points! My only complaint was there wasn't a clear way on how to continue to read this story. Afterwards, I subscribed to Marvel Unlimited and regret nothing.
